ASIC1a Promotes nucleus pulposus derived stem cells apoptosis through modulation of SIRT3-dependent mitochondrial redox homeostasis in intervertebral disc degeneration
The death of human nucleus pulposus derived stem cells (NPSCs) is a key factor affecting the endogenous repair capability and degeneration of intervertebral discs (IVD).
